
All INdiana Politics Conversations: Ed DeLaney, pt. 2
After the adoption of the Dayton Peace Accords in 1995, future state Rep. Ed DeLaney, then a lawyer, found himself negotiating the final status of the Brcko region of what is now Bosnia and Herzegovina. In part 2 of a series, DeLaney describes the experience of working in the Balkans amid the Yugoslav Wars.
